Subject: Re: [PATCH v2 3/7] KVM-HV: KVM Steal time implementation

On Sun, Jun 19, 2011 at 12:57:53PM +0300, Avi Kivity wrote:
> On 06/17/2011 01:20 AM, Glauber Costa wrote:
> >To implement steal time, we need the hypervisor to pass the guest information
> >about how much time was spent running other processes outside the VM.
> >This is per-vcpu, and using the kvmclock structure for that is an abuse
> >we decided not to make.
> >
> >In this patchset, I am introducing a new msr, KVM_MSR_STEAL_TIME, that
> >holds the memory area address containing information about steal time
> >
> >This patch contains the hypervisor part for it. I am keeping it separate from
> >the headers to facilitate backports to people who wants to backport the kernel
> >part but not the hypervisor, or the other way around.

> This records time spent in userspace in the vcpu thread as steal
> time.  Is this what we want?  Or just time preempted away?

It also accounts halt time (kvm_vcpu_block) as steal time. Glauber, you
could instead use the "runnable-state-but-waiting-in-runqueue" field of
SCHEDSTATS, i forgot the exact name.
